JACKET LAPEL

Notch Lapel

Also called as the step lapel, a notched lapel is sewn to the collar to create a step effect, i.e. it is sewn at an angle.

By Default
Occasion Business and Formal
Width Based on Size
Customization lapel width
Yes

PEAK LAPEL

The peak lapel has a V cut or a tick cut to be precise. This is then sewn to the collar.

By Default
Occasion Formal and Business
Width Based on Size
Customization lapel width
Yes

SHAWL LAPEL

The shawl lapel does not differ from the collar, it is a perpetual curve. It is not sewn in. The shawl collar continues to the shawl lapel.

By Default
Occasion Formal
Width Based on Size
Customization lapel width
Yes

MAO COLLAR

The Mao collar, is a small, close-fitting, stand up collar. The Edges don't meet in the middle and it it similar to Nehru Collar.

By Default
Occasion Formal
Width 1 ½" inches
Customization lapel width
No

CHINESE COLLAR

The Chinese collar, is a small, close-fitting, stand up collar just similar to Mao Collar. The Edges do meet in the middle with a button.

By Default
Occasion Formal
Width 1 ½" inches
Customization lapel width
No

JACKET LAPEL WIDTH

Jacket Lapel Width Reference

Standard Measurements

Notch lapels measuring 3½ inches (8-10 cm) complement most men, aligning with standard tie widths of 3 to 3½ inches. Peak lapels typically extend beyond 4+ inches.

Impact on Appearance

  • Wider lapels enhance chest appearance
  • Narrower lapels create broader shoulders
  • Balanced proportions are key

Body Type Guidelines

  • Slender builds: Narrower lapels
  • Larger builds: Wider lapels
  • Match proportions to body type

Lapel Styling

  • Straight cut: Sharp "V" shape
  • Curved cut: Subtle "U" shape
  • Belly curve for relaxed look

JACKET CHEST POCKET

Welt Pocket

Welt Pocket

Welt pockets are either found on the front of a man's tailored jacket, with a handkerchief tucked in to them, or on the reverse of a pair of jeans. They are bound, flat pockets that have finished with a welt or reinforced border along the edge of a piece of fabric.

Jetted Pocket

Jetted Pocket

Explaining why jetted pockets are typically the most formal types of pockets. Instead of being a pouch sewn onto the outside of the jacket, a jetted pocket is a slit in the facing of the jacket, with the pouch hanging inside.

Patch Pocket

Patch Pocket

A pocket made of a separate piece of cloth sewn on to the outside of a garment.

JACKET SPLIT OR VENT

A vent is the cut you see on the rear of overcoats, jackets, suit coats, and some other sort of coat. Advantage of the back vent is that it licenses simpler access to your pant pocket: the give from the vent refutes overabundance texture assembling and pulling as you burrow your hand under the coat to get into your pocket.

LINING

Jacket Lining

The canvas is a layer of material attached to the inside of a jacket to give it shape, while the lining is a thinner layer of cloth that lies between the wearer's body and the canvas and jacket interior. Some jackets are unlined.


JACKET PICK STITCHING


PICK STITCHING

Hand stitching is recognisably as large, deliberate stitching in a contrasting color that runs along the lapel, around the pocket flaps, and sometimes as detailing on the breast pocket of a tailored suit.

This subtle detailing can either be hand stitched or machine made.
